If you decide to buy two-seater leather Chesterfield, make sure to choose a sofa made of premium quality materials. Leather is the most popular option for this type of sofa, and premium leather should be soft and comfortable enough for everyday use. Leather is also water resistant and can be handy for homes with families.

Faux leather is a popular alternative to real leather and can offer a more sustainable and animal friendly solution. However, it is crucial to take into consideration the materials used in a faux-leather sofa before you buy it. Low-quality faux leather may be prone to creasing or flattening over time, so be sure that you're choosing a reputable brand.

In terms of cushion filling, a high-quality sofa will have an ample amount of polyester or foam which give the sofa a cosy and supportive feel when sat upon. Mixing different densities will also improve the comfort of the sofa. These fillings work in conjunction with a top-quality suspension system to ensure that the sofa keeps its shape and does not fall apart after repeated use.
